Why Egyptian Cotton and Handwoven Fabrics Matter in Sustainable Fashion

Sustainable fashion begins with conscious material choices. Egyptian cotton and handwoven fabrics have long been celebrated for their quality, durability, and minimal environmental impact.

What Makes Egyptian Cotton Unique?Egyptian cotton is known for its long fibers, which create softer, stronger, and more breathable fabrics. When sourced responsibly, it supports local agriculture and reduces the need for synthetic alternatives.

Handwoven Fabrics and Ethical Craftsmanship in Egypt
Handwoven textiles, especially those produced in Upper Egypt, preserve traditional skills while providing fair employment opportunities. Each piece reflects time, care, and cultural heritage.

Why Natural Fabrics Are Essential for Slow Fashion
Natural fibers age beautifully, last longer, and encourage mindful consumption. Choosing quality over quantity is at the heart of slow fashion.
